Traditional Grain with Modern Benefits
Ragi, also known as finger millet, is an extraordinary superfood that has been cultivated in India for generations. This packed grain is becoming increasingly popular in modern diets due to its impressive advantages. Ragi is packed with essential nutrients, including calcium, iron, and fiber. Its adaptability makes it a perfect option for a variety of dishes.
Arrowroot Power: Naturally Gluten-Free and Versatile
Arrowroot, a starch extracted from the rhizomes of the arrowroot plant, is gaining popularity as a naturally gluten-free replacement. Its smooth texture and neutral flavor make it incredibly versatile in both sweet and savory dishes. From thickening sauces to creating crisp batters, arrowroot delivers impressive results. Its ability to form stable gels even at low concentrations makes it ideal for applications requiring a clear, glossy finish. Whether you're baking gluten-free goodies or simply looking for a healthier alternative to traditional thickeners, arrowroot enables culinary creativity without compromising on taste and texture.
